Abstract: In response to rapid technological advancements, this research emphasizes the need to modernize traditional teaching methods, particularly in Arabic language education. Technology has become essential in improving education quality and fostering student-teacher interaction. The study explores the impact of technology on Arabic language education by defining "didactics," addressing challenges in traditional education, and comparing traditional curricula with technology-based ones. Additionally, it reviews successful examples of digital tool integration. The findings reveal that technology enhances education quality, increases interaction, provides personalized learning opportunities, and makes the educational process more efficient and flexible by offering innovative resources. Keywords: Digital technology, didactics, Arabic language, educational computer
